UW–Madison’s Lent, Kallio earn 2021 awards from AERA’s Division A


UW–Madison student Sarah Lent and alumna Julie Kallio are both receiving 2021 awards from Division A (Administration, Organization, and Leadership) of the American Educational Research Association (AERA).

Sarah Lent and Julie Kallio
Lent (left) and Kallio

Lent is a PhD student in the School of Education’s Department of Educational Leadership and Policy Analysis (ELPA). She is one of four recipients of Division A’s Foster-Polite Scholarship, a $500 award for recognizing scholarly excellence in educational administration, school leadership, or related fields.

Kallio earned an Honorable Mention for Division A’s Outstanding Dissertation Award, for her dissertation that is titled, “Solving Problems Together: Findings from the Early Stages of a Networked Improvement Community.”

Kallio graduated with her PhD from ELPA in 2020, and is currently an innovation specialist at The Breck School in Minneapolis, Minnesota.
